Read MoreBucks’ Brogdon out for games 1 and 2
Milwaukee Bucks point guard Malcom Brogdon is going to miss games 1and 2 of their Eastern Conference Semifinals series against the Boston Celtics, according to Bucks head coach Mike Budenholzer. Brogdon has been out of the Milwaukee lineup since suffering a minor tear in the plantar fascia in his right foot in mid-March. He was originally expected to be out six to eight weeks. This season Brogdon averaged 15.6 points, 4.5 rebounds and 3.2 assists in 28.6 minutes per contest.
